## Break-Glass: Partner SFTP Drop (Harborline)

Plugin authors normally push artifacts through the Harborline publish API. If the API is down for more than one hour and a release deadline applies, you may use the emergency SFTP drop instead. Upload to the `incoming/` folder only, with a signed manifest. The drop account stays disabled until unlocked; unlocking requires the break-glass recovery passphrase shown below.

vault phrase of bagaf-kajeg = jorath-feniel-briir-siliel-ralix

We also changed the default diff threshold to be stricter, since the looser setting masked genuine rendering regressions in themed components. Plugins that deliberately render nondeterministic output should override these values in their own manifest. The new default snapshot settings applied by the test runner are listed below.

settings of hafop-kadug:
[holok]
team = ralok
access_code = ac_6c3c97
host = holok.brasksoft.corp
port = 8000
owner = ulaath.ralix
peer = belax.qorvelsys.test

Welcome to the Pulsegrid on-call rotation. The metrics-aggregation sidecar, codenamed Tallyvane, runs beside every service pod and flushes rollups to the Corvel warehouse every thirty seconds. If Tallyvane stalls, restart it only after confirming the buffer directory is empty, otherwise you will double-count samples. Redeploying the sidecar requires a signed manifest, so verify the bundle before pushing. Use the deploy key below when signing the manifest.

rollout seal: bky4_x7Gc

- [ ] Step 7: Archive cold storage buckets (Glacierline tier). Confirm both ceremony witnesses are present, verify bucket manifests match the Oxbow ledger, then seal the archive key shares. Plugin authors may observe but not handle shares. Once sealed, the archive index itself is encrypted and can only be reopened with the passphrase below.

vault phrase of badup-hahig = tamael-aldael-kelmir-istael-fenok-istwyn-tamius-jorath-oliion